您好,欢迎访问三七文档
当前位置:首页 > IT计算机/网络 > 电子商务 > 电子商务技术基础练习题与答案
1一、填空题、1、HTML是[HyperTextMarkupLanguage]的英文缩写,它最早源于SGML标记语言。2、所有网页都是由浏览器对HTML解释而形成的。[浏览器]就相当于HTML语言翻译程序,负责解释HTML文件的各种符号的含义。3、XML的英文全称是[ExtensibleMarkupLanguage],它是一种类似于HTML的标记语言。4、XML文档包含七个主要部分,分别是[序言码、处理指、根元素、元素、属性、CDATA节和注释].5、XML的元素由[起始标记]、[中间数据(内容)]和[结束标记]三部分组成。6、标准的CGI程序是通过[环境变量]和[标准输入输出]与Web服务器交换信息的。7、为了将ASP代码与HTML标记符区分开来,ASP代码应用[%]和[%]符号将其括起来。8、任何一个Web服务器,只要内嵌[ASP解释器]就可以支持ASP编写的动态网页。9、ASP的Response对象的主要功能是[向客户端浏览器发送数据]。10、在ASP中,设置Session过期的属性是[TimeOut]。11、PHP是一种面向[表达式]的语言,几乎所有的东西都是[表达式]。12、PHP参数传递方式默认情况是[传值方式]。13、.NET框架由[程序设计语言]、[应用程序平台]、[ADO.NET及类库]、[公共语言运行库]和[NET开发环境]五部分组成。14、.NET框架中包括一个庞大的类库。为了便于调用,将其中的类按照[命名空间]进行逻辑区分。15、ASPX网页的代码存储模式有两种,它们是[代码分离模式和单一模式]。16、ASPX网页的基类是[]。二、单项选择题1、下面是静态网页文件的扩展名的是(C)A.aspB.aspxC.htmD.Jsp2、下面关于绝对路径的说法正确的是(D)A.绝对路径是被链接文档的完整URL,不包括使用的传输协议B.绝对路径是被链接文档的完整URL,不包括文件名C.绝对路径是被链接文档的完整URL,不包括文件虚拟路径D.创建外部链接时,必须使用绝对路径3、以下标记符中,用于设置页面标题的是(A)A.titleB.captionC.headD.html4、以下标记符中,没有结束标记的是(B)A.bodyB.brC.htmlD.title5、下面四个叙述中,正确的是(C)A.XML是制作网页的标记语言B.XML是制作网页的编程语言C.XML描述数据的标记语言D.XML描述数据的编程语言6、利用ASP开发的网页,其扩展名应命名为(C)A..htmB..aspxC..aspD.无严格限制7、ASP网页是在(B)执行的。A.客户端浏览器B.服务器端C.第一次在服务器端,以后在客户端D.没有定论8、服务器端要获得客户端所提交的表单数据,应使用(A)对象来实现。A.Request请求,要求B.Response响应,回答,反应C.Server伺候者D.Session会议,学期9、若表单提交的数据中包含着图形,或大数量的文本,此时表单的提交方法应该采用(C)A.Get获得,记住B.Submit递交,登陆C.Post公布,帖子,发布者D.Resct10、在服务器端,若要将页面导航到index.asp,应使用Response对象的(D)方法来实现.A.href(hypertextreference);超链接B.Transfer转让,传递C.Flush清仓,冲洗D.Redirect更改方向11、若要获得当前正在执行的脚本所在页面的虚拟路径,以下用法中,正确的是(A)。A.Requst请求ServerVariables变量(“SCRIPT脚本_NAME”)2B.Response响应ServerVariables(“SCRIPT_NAME”)C.RequstServerVariables(“PATH_TRANSLATED”翻译路径)D.ResponseServerVariables(“PATH_TRANSLATED”)12、在ASP中,创建对象通常用(C)对象的CreatObject方法来实现。A.RequestB.Object目标C.Server服务器端D.Application应用,申请,对象13、在.NET中,CLS(CommonLanguageSpecification),的作用是(D)A.存储代码B.防止病毒C.源程序跨平台D.对语言进行规范14、在ASP.NET中,源程序代码先被生成中间代码(IL或MSIL),然后再转变成各个CPU需要的代码,其目的是(C)A.提高效率B.保证安全C.跨平台应用D.易识别15、当需要用控件来输入性别“男、女”或婚姻状况“已婚、未婚”时,为了简化输入,应该选用的控件是(D)A.RadioButton按键B.CheckBoxListC.CheckBoxD.RadioButtonList16、.NET提供数据库通用接口的目的是为了(B)A.提高程序运行的效率B.应用程序设计不必考虑数据库的类型C.保证程序的安全D.提高存储效率三.判断题、1、服务器是一种特殊的应用程序。对2、HTML是一种网页编程语言。错3、HTML标记符不区分大小写。对4、HTML标记府都必须配对和成组使用。错5、在IE中、通过“查看”菜单下的“源文件”菜单项可查看到HTML网页的源代码。对6、XML语言中的标记由设计者自行定义,用来描述元素的内容。对7、像HTML一样、XML某些标记可以没有结束。错8、XML中的标记的名称的字符串只能包含英文字母,不能包含数字。错9、ASP是一个完全的面向对象的系统。错10、开发ASP网页所使用的脚本语言只能采用VBScript。错11、ASP网页运行时在客户端无法查看到真实的ASP源代码。对12、网页中的ASP代码同html标记符一样,必须用分隔符“”号“”将其括起来。错13、使用ASP技术时,利用Session和Application对象存储变量,可创建作用域跨页,甚至跨用户的变量。对14、在PHP中,函数内使用的变量被默认设置为全局变量。错15、在MySQL中,使用LOADDATA语句可以为数据库装载数据。对16、PHP的mysql_connect()函数与mysql_pconnect()函数的功能没有什么区别。错17、HTML控件很难转换为服务器控件。错18、网站中的Global.asax文件,如果有的话,必须放在应用程序的根目录下。对19、代码分离模式的网页运行效率要高于单一模式的网页。错四、简答题1、静态网页和动态网页运行时的最大区别在哪里答:静态网页以HTML源文件的形式存储在服务器端的存储设备上,当服务器接收到浏览器的页面请求时,服务器直接从存储设备上找到相应的HTML源文件,发给浏览器。动态网页在服务器端不直接存储,当服务器接收到浏览器的页面请求时,服务器启动特定的程序代码,动态生成相应的HTML网页文件,然后发送给浏览器。2、HTML页面的基本结构是怎样的“HTMLHEAD文件头/HEADBODY文件体/BODY/HTML”(请详细说明每部分的作用)33、试述XML的语法规定,并请举例说明。答:1)XML的元素。XML元素是XML文档的基本构成单元。XML的元素由起始标记、中间数据内容、和结束标记三部分组成。2)−名称的开头必须是字母或“_”−标记名称中不能有空格−名称的字符串只能包含英文字母、数字、“_”、“-”、“.”等字符这些规则也是后面要讲到的“属性”以及XML文档中其它实体的命名规则。3)−必须具有根标记−开始标记和结束标记需配对使用,−标记不能交错使用,−标记对大小写敏感。4、简述CGI的基本原理与主要操作过程。答:首先,用户通过客户端的浏览器向Web服务器发送请求。要注意,用户向Web服务器发送的请求中会包含指向一个CGI程序的URL和一些要处理的数据。然后服务器接受请求,按照请求中的URL,寻找相应的CGI程序文件,运行该程序,并且把要处理的数据提交给CGI程序。CGI程序对服务器提交来的数据进行处理。处理过程中可能会访问其它系统,与其它系统交换数据,或者要访问数据库,对数据库进行操作。CGI程序完成数据处理之后,把处理结果返回给Web服务器。CGI程序的输出通常就是一个HTML页面文件。最后Web服务器把从CGI程序获取的HTML网页文件通过网络传送给客户端的浏览器。在这个过程中,CGI是Web服务器和外部程序的接口,是Web服务器和外部程序的之间的通信规范,它就像Web服务器和CGI程序之间通信的桥梁。Web服务器与CGI程序交换数据的方式是这样的,Web服务器一般将客户端传送来的信息放在它的标准输入和相关环境变量中,而CGI程序则从环境变量和它的标准输入,也就是Web服务器的标准输出中获取所需的信息,程序最终输出结果则被写向它的标准输出,也就是Web服务器的标准输入。Web服务器将从它的标准输入获取CGI程序的输出结果并将它传送给客户端。5、什么是Cookie?在ASP编程时如何使用Cookie保存客户的网页访问信息?答:Cookie是一个Web服务器放在用户浏览器上的信息。当再次使用相同的浏览器请求同一页时,它就把以前Web服务器写到浏览器的Cookie值再传给Web服务器。Cookie允许一个用户关联一系列信息,ASP脚本可以通过Response对象和Request对象的Cookies集合设置和取得这些信息。6、请描述ASP.NET的工作原理。答:SP.NET的工作原理时基于网络传输的,并改变了传统的ASP工作原理,将部分原来有服务器执行的工作交给了客户机。ASP.NET的程序被访问时要先经过遍历成MSIL(MicrosoftIntermediateLanguage)语言然后MSIL再被编译成机器码执行。7、一个答:一个,也是程序部署的基本单位。应用程序由多种文件组成,通常包括以下5部分:一个在IIS信息服务器中的虚拟目录。这个虚拟目录被配置为应用程序的根目录。一个或多个带.aspx扩展名的网页文件,还允许放入若干.htm或.asp网页文件。一个或多个Web.config配置文件。一个以Global.asax命名的全局文件。App_Code和App_Data共享目录。
本文标题:电子商务技术基础练习题与答案
链接地址:https://www.777doc.com/doc-7426140 .html